Jelly Bean ported to the Galaxy SIII

Developer Faryaab ported Jelly Bean to the Galaxy S III.
Faryaab is busy at the moment to make the rom more stable and to fix all bugs.
Below a list what works and what doesn’t work.

What Works:

  • ADB
  • Touchscreen
  • Hardware Acceleration
  • Notification LED
  • Cellular Rado (But No Audio so no Calls)
  • Physical Buttons
  • SMS
  • Accelerometer
  • Charging
  • Maybe More


What Doesn’t work:

  • Wi-Fi/Bluetooth/NFC
  • Audio
  • Camera
  • MTP
  • Storage
  • Maybe more
